#19439c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19439c is composed of 9.8% red, 26.3%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 220.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 35.5%. #19439c color hex could be obtained by blending #3286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#19439c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#19439c has RGB values of R:25, G:67,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1655708.

Shades and Tints of #19439c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f2f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#19439c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58595d is the less saturated color, while #043cb1 is the most saturated one.
